Essential Guidelines for Yearly Cleaning and Creosote Removal
For optimal safety and efficiency, schedule a CSIA-certified maintenance service once per heating season - or schedule additional services for frequent use or detect Stage 2-3 creosote. This aligns with NFPA 211 recommendations and minimizes creosote buildup. Plan ahead with seasonal scheduling to secure preferred dates. A certified professional will inspect chimney integrity, ventilation effectiveness, safety distances, and connection integrity, followed by removing soot and creosote deposits using specially designed maintenance tools and HEPA vacuum technology.
You can help between visits by maintaining these practices: stick to seasoned hardwood (containing less than 20% moisture), ensure proper air flow to stop smoldering, and maintain flue temperatures steady. Install a thermometer on stoves and ensure smoke path components are secure. After using each cord, check for 1/8 inch deposits; when reaching 1/4 inch, stop using the appliance until properly cleaned.
Expert Services: Masonry Work, Crown & Cap Repairs, Waterproofing Solutions
Following creosote maintenance, you must preserve the chimney's construction and weatherproofing. Weather cycles in Ohio frequently harm brick and mortar joints, so schedule masonry maintenance using ASTM-compliant masonry materials and compatible joint tooling for current mortar joints. Repair damaged crowns using a reinforced, fiber-reinforced cement mixture, correctly sloped and featuring an protruding drainage edge for moisture control. Fit or update stainless-steel caps with anti-corrosion fasteners and correctly fitted spark arrestors designed to the chimney outlet.
Prioritize the repair of flashing where roofs intersect, properly installing step and counter-flashing within mortar joints. Seal all laps and maintain proper clearance from combustible materials according to NFPA 211 standards. Treat exterior masonry with vapor-permeable waterproofing and don't use film-forming sealers that lock in moisture. Document thoroughly all repairs, curing periods, and warranties, and establish routine seasonal inspections to monitor effectiveness.

Liner Material Choices
The key to picking a suitable chimney liner material begins with coordinating it to your appliance, fuel type, and local code requirements. Stainless steel options provide durability and are UL-listed for various fuel sources including wood, oil, and gas. You may select rigid stainless for straight flues or flexible stainless for bends; opt for 316 steel for oil/wood applications and 304 for gas when permitted. Install required insulation to ensure clearance-to-combustibles and proper flue gas temperatures.
Ceramic solutions include clay tile and cast-in-place systems. Clay offers an affordable solution for new masonry construction but requires appropriate sizing and intact joints. Cast-in-place liners strengthen older stacks and provide an uninterrupted, heat-resistant flue.
Factor in corrosion class, temperature shock endurance, and diameter sizing following NFPA 211 and manufacturer specifications. Always verify connection compatibility, terminal fittings, and Ohio building code compliance prior to installation.
Protection and Productivity
Although choosing a liner starts with dimensional requirements and materials, performance and safety rely on the liner's ability to manage draft, heat, and combustion residues according to building codes. There must be a continuous, properly sized flue path to stabilize draft, maximize ventilation efficiency, and avoid cooling of exhaust gases that creates acidic or creosote condensation. Adequate insulation preserves exhaust temperature, improving combustion efficiency and minimizing ignition risks. Chemical-resistant liners manage CO and moisture, protecting the masonry and nearby combustible materials.
Align the liner diameter to match the appliance outlet following NFPA 211 and manufacturer listings; using too large a diameter weakens draft, insufficient diameter raises stack temperature and gas escape. Check all connections and spacing meet gas-tight standards. Place carbon monoxide detectors for each story and close to sleeping areas. Arrange annual Level II evaluations and document performance measurements: CO levels, draft measurements, and temperature readings.

Advantages of Top-Sealing Dampers
Many homeowners overlook the importance of a top-sealing damper, which provides crucial protection by sealing the flue at the chimney crown. This important component eliminates conditioned air loss, blocks annoying downdrafts, and protects against water intrusion and animals. By creating a seal at the top, it effectively minimizes the cold air column in the flue, boosting energy conservation and reducing stack-effect heat loss during Ohio's extended heating season. Additionally, you'll safeguard your flue from rain and snow damage, reducing freeze-thaw damage and wear.
The unit features stainless hardware and a high-temperature gasket, working via a firebox-mounted cable. You must open it completely before starting any fire to maintain proper combustion and safe venting as specified by NFPA 211. Our team size and secure the frame to match your flue tile, confirm lid travel and seal compression, and ensure smoke-tight closure for regulation-compliant performance.

What's the Average Cost of Chimney and Fireplace Services in Ohio?
You'll typically pay $100-$250 for a Level 1 sweep, $200-$400 for chimney inspections, and $300-$1,200 for basic masonry and crown work. Full relining costs $1,500-$4,000; tuckpointing typically costs $8-$20 per linear foot. New installations and rebuilds depend on local codes and material choices. Expect emergency fees of $100-$300 for non-standard hours. Request written, code-compliant scope including NFPA 211 standards and insurance verification. Confirm Level 2/3 inspection requirements when transferring property or after fire-related incidents.
